Analysis
In 2023, horses — manure applied to soils in United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land stood at 1.22 million kg. That is the highest value across all 63 years on record.
Compared with earlier readings it is up 4.4% on the previous year and up 48.3% over ten years.
Over the whole period, horses — manure applied to soils in United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land peaked at 1.22 million kg in 2023 and was at its lowest, 200,353 kg, in 1976.
That places United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land 14th out of 164 countries with data for 2023, putting it in the top 10%.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

About this data
The Livestock Manure domain of FAOSTAT contains estimates of nitrogen (N) inputs to agricultural soils from livestock manure. Data on the N losses to air and water are also disseminated. These estimates are compiled using official FAOSTAT statistics of animal stocks and by applying the internationally approved Guidelines of the Intergovernmental Panel on Climate Change (IPCC). Data are available by country, with global coverage and updated annually.The following elements are disseminated: 1) Stocks; 2) Amount excreted in manure (N content); 3) Manure left on pasture (N content); 4) Manure left on pasture that volatilises (N content); 5) Manure left on pasture that leaches (N content); 6) Manure treated (N content); 7) Losses from manure treated (N content); 8) Manure applied to soils (N content); 9) Manure applied to soils that volatilises (N content); 10) Manure applied to soils that leaches (N content).
